InventHelp Inventor Develops Ornate Toilet Decoration (KPD-125)
Pittsburgh, PA (PRWEB) December 24, 2013 -- Tired of looking at the same boring, old toilet day in and day out? Why not spice things up with the DECO TOILET?
Developed by an inventor from Newton Square, Pa., the accessory improves the appearance of the toilet bowl. The unit adds a fun festive element to the bowl. It also masks unpleasant toilet odors to keep the bathroom smelling fresh. The device can be made in designs for use with any holiday, season, special occasion or other event. Additionally, it is usable with any toilet.
The inventor's personal experience inspired his idea. "I wanted to make a toilet look more inviting and decorative," he said. "I do not think that the conventional bowl fresheners do a very good job of this, so I came up with my own alternative."
The original design was submitted to the King of Prussia office of InventHelp. It is currently available for licensing or sale to manufacturers or marketers.
